Bifold Door uPVC
If you're seeking a way to connect your home to the outside or to create the illusion of space bifold doors are the best option. These doors feature a concertina-style opening that creates a stylish transition from the inside to the outside and allows plenty of light to enter the home.
With a sleek and modern look they're ideal to add a contemporary look to any room. They maximise your outdoor space by allowing as much as 90% of their aperture to be open.
Bifold doors made of uPVC are constructed to last and will not bend, warp or twist in the same way as timber or aluminium equivalents. They are also easy to clean, only requiring one wipe with a soft cloth every now and then.
This allows you to enjoy your bifold door installation for a long time and is a long-term investment for any Aylesbury home improvement.
They're capable of achieving thermal efficiency levels of up to 1.2 W/m2K. This will keep your home cool in summer and warm in winter. This can reduce harmful UV rays entering the home and prevent heat from escape, allowing you save money on your energy costs.

French Doors uPVC
If you are looking to connect your Buckinghamshire home with your garden, uPVC French Doors are the perfect solution. These double doors are designed without a central column, which allows for clear views and ease of entry or exit. They are also a popular way to connect an orangery or conservatory to your home, as they can be opened fully to let the light in through.
They can also be designed to suit any kind of home, just like uPVC Windows. They come in a range of colors and finishes that can be matched to any design either contemporary or traditional. They can also be fitted with a detailed glass panel to provide an additional visual interest to your home.

uPVC Conservatories
A uPVC conservatory is an ideal way to create space in your home. These stunning structures, which are predominately constructed of glass, create a bright and airy space that can be used to entertain guests, relaxing with family, or even as a dining area. The uPVC frames are strong, durable and resistant to weather damage, so you can rest assured that your new conservatory will remain in excellent condition for the years to come.
If you're looking for traditional Victorian conservatory, or one that's modern and sleek, there is a uPVC conservatory style that will fit your home. Lean-to conservatories, that are simply square or rectangular spaces, are the most affordable option for homeowners. With a roof that slopes away from your property and large glass windows, they let an abundance of light into the conservatory.
A uPVC Edwardian conservatory is another popular option for homeowners. With a beautiful symmetry and clean lines conservatories add style to your home while maintaining moderate temperatures throughout the year.
